The Nadesalingam family have celebrated little Tharnicaa's fifth birthday in Biloela today. This is Tharnicaa's first birthday she has celebrated out of detention. MORE: 9News

After finally welcoming the family home this week 'the little town that could' has come together with four very special guests of honour.

A small community that sparked a nationwide fight to bring Priya, Nades, Kopika and Tharnicaa back to Biloela has a lot to celebrate"All the different nationalities get in their costumes and cook all their food- some great tukka, I can tell you that," Biloela's mayor said.As the grateful family enjoy the festivities, Nades went around the event, individually thanking members of the community for their support.
